I am getting these errors when a user tries to send mail from any mail program, such as pine, or just "sendmail" or anything. in root, I get no such errors, except when logged in as a user besides root.

In pine:
[Mail not sent. Sending error: 421 4.3.0 collect: Cannot write ./dfg12M]

Other:
bash-2.05$ sendmail stratus@swcempire.com
Testin
collect: Cannot write ./dfg14MhPbP002936 (bfcommit, uid=13, gid=1007): Permission denied
queueup: cannot create queue temp file ./tfg14MhPbP002936, uid=13: Permission denied
bash-2.05$

Any ideas?
